The New York Rangers'and Washington Capitals meet in Game 3 of a best-of-7 Eastern Conference 1st-round series Friday. Puck drop from Capital One Arena is scheduled for 7 p.m. ET (TNT). Below, we analyze BetMGM Sportsbook’s'lines around the Rangers vs. Capitals odds, and make our expert NHL picks and predictions.

The Rangers control the series 2-0 after taking down the Capitals 4-3 Tuesday to cash as -281 home favorites. Four different NY players found the back of the net, while LW Alexis Lafreniere'and D'Erik Gustafsson'each had 2 assists. The team has scored 4 goals in each of the 1st 2 games of the series.

Washington failed to cash as a +245 road underdog Tuesday. After allowing 2 goals in each of the 1st 2 periods, Washington’s comeback fell short. Three different Capitals players scored, while RW Tom Wilson'had a goal and an assist. The series moves back to Washington Friday where the Capitals were 22-12-7 during the regular season.
